Oregon SB 128 (2023R1) — Relating to salary under the Public Employees Retirement System.

Provides that, for purposes of determining salary of certain member of Public Employees Retirement System, housing allowance paid to prison chaplain shall be treated as includable in member's taxable income under Oregon law.
